- Performs a variety of high quality clinical and research Cardiac MRI exams and differentiates protocols and sequences as needed for each exam. Adjusts or changes scan protocol based on cardiac findings observed during CMR exam. Identifies when to switch from one sequence to another and takes appropriate action in order to provide the proper information to the physician.
- Screens patient for caffeine prior to vasodilator stress MRI. Utilizes knowledge of the common cardiac issues that would prompt a CMR stress exam. Applies understanding of basic congenital heart disease (aortic coarctation, bicuspid aortic valve, ASD/VSD, repaired tetralogy of Fallot) for indication of a scan.
- Effectively implements protocols and objectives with team members to result in optimization of staff performance, teamwork, patient safety, and customer service. Drives improvement of department score for patient satisfaction, through peer-to-peer accountability for service standards.
- Follows stress perfusion MRI protocol, valve regurgitation and stenosis protocols and basic congenital heart disease protocols: Aorta coarctation, ASD/VSD, sinus venosus defect, repaired tetralogy of Fallot during procedures.
- Independently post processes and establishes measurements needed for physician’s readings. Performs Advanced post processing including: 4D Flow and Myocardial Strain and 3D graphical reconstructions including generating MIP volume rendered images of all thoracic, abdominal and extremity vascular exams.
